The working principles and phenomena the SQUID technology is based on are not so easy to understand by those, who want to use the technology for specific applications. This book builds a bridge for scientists and engineers to fill potential know-how gaps for all working together on SQUID systems and their practical applications. Key words like readout electronics, flux quantization, Josephson effects or noise contributions will be no obstacle for the design and use of simple and robust SQUID systems.
